Section 3 - Conguration
Time
Displays the current time and date of the
DWR-116.
Select the appropriate Time Zone from the
drop-down box.
Select this checkbox to automatically
synchronize the DWR-116 with an Internet
time server.
Choose the NTP Server used for synchronizing
time and date.
Shows the result of the last time
synchronization.
Click Save Settings to save your changes,
or click Don’t Save Settings to discard your
changes.
This section will help you set the time zone that you are in and
the NTP (Network Time Protocol) server. Daylight Saving can also
be configured to adjust the time when needed.

D-Link DWR-116 Specifications

Data Rates and Standards IconData Rates and Standards
data rates in 802.11n mode300, 150, 135, 120, 90, 60, 45, 30, 15 Mbps
data rates in 802.11g mode6/9/11/12/18/24/36/48/54Mbps
data rates in 802.11b mode1/2/5.5/11Mbps
Frequency and Security IconFrequency and Security
frequency2.4 - 2.4835 GHz
wireless security64/128-bit WEP, WPA & WPA2
Ports and Antenna IconPorts and Antenna
ports4 x LAN (RJ-45), 1x WAN, 1 x USB
Power and Dimensions IconPower and Dimensions
power adapterExternal 5 V DC 2 A
dimensions148.5 x 113.5 x 25 mm, 5.85 x 4.47 x .98 inches
Operating Environment IconOperating Environment
operating temperature0 to 40 °C, 32 to 104 °F
operating humidity10% to 95% non-condensing
